How they compare
Gabon currently reports 2,487 kilograms per person against 2,426 kilograms per person in Russia, a difference of 61 kilograms per person.
The two have swapped places 2 times across 34 shared years of data; in 1990 it was Gabon ahead.
Gabon ranks 12th and Russia ranks 13th of 193 countries.
Gabon has averaged higher in every one of the 4 decades both report.
Head to head by decade
| Decade | Gabon | Russia |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 8,806 kilograms per person | 1,897 kilograms per person | 6,908 kilograms per person | Gabon |
| 2000s | 6,284 kilograms per person | 2,253 kilograms per person | 4,032 kilograms per person | Gabon |
| 2010s | 3,516 kilograms per person | 2,264 kilograms per person | 1,252 kilograms per person | Gabon |
| 2020s | 2,444 kilograms per person | 2,419 kilograms per person | 24.95 kilograms per person | Gabon |
Averages of every year both report within each decade.
